1樓:
你的**有幾處問題:
list.remove(num)多餘了,你並沒有把那個數字加到過list裡面,所以沒有必要移除。
print "maximum is", largest 這段應該寫到loop外面來,使得程式走完整個list之後print最大值,而不是找到一個比前面一個數字大的就立刻print出來。後面minimum也是這個問題。
以下是改好的**:
largest = none
**allest = none
list =
while true:
num = raw_input("enter a number: ")
if num == "done" : break
try:
except:
print "invalid input"
for i in list:
if largest is none:
largest = list[0]
elif largest < i:
largest = i
print "maximum is", largest
for i in list:
if **allest is none:
**allest = list[0]
elif **allest > i:
**allest = i
print "minimum is", **allest
另外有兩個小建議:
最好不要把list作為變數名,因為list在python裡是預先定義好的,這樣寫會覆蓋原來的定義。
可以把找最大最小值的**寫進一個function裡面,然後最後呼叫一次印出結果。這樣會整潔明瞭一些
希望對你有幫助。
高中入門精要上的數學題,求解題過程,題目見補充,謝謝
1,設a x 1 x,x 1 x a 2 2 a 2 3a 1 0,即2a 3a 5 0 解得a 1,5 2 當x 1 x 1時,x x 1 0,無實數解,複數解 1 2 3 i 2 當x 1 x 5 2時,2x 5x 2 0,x 2,1 2 2,裂項 1 1 2 3 1 2 3 4 1 n n 1...
PS,這種光效是怎麼做出來的呢?小白求解求詳細方法
拉漸變c 100 c 30 c 50 直線2條 上模糊 簡單蒙版 畫圓 鎖用陰影 不用全域性光 隨意畫一個矩形的光條然後模糊 高斯模糊調整到想要的效果 新建圖層,模式 正常 改成 柔光 用畫筆畫線條,可以疊加到原圖層上,通過模糊處理,類似月光照射效果 雙擊圖層,圖層樣式對話方塊裡,可調外發光,或者將...
做夢夢見白龍,求解,夢見小白龍是怎樣的徵兆?求高手解夢!
如果夢見龍bai 一般來說會得到 du上天賜予zhi的名譽和財富dao 依lz的夢境 可能命中註定近版期會有意外之財權的驚喜 以及工作上學習上的升遷機會 一條白色的龍,在不停的尋找我 但是lz說 前後三次想要噴水攻擊我,不過都沒打到 這說明 可能是曇花一現 最終還是得不到應該得到的驚喜不過該來的始終...